Embedded Ferroelectric Nanoclusters Can Drive Polarization Reversal in a Non‐Ferroelectric Polar Film via the Proximity Effect

open access: yesAdvanced Functional Materials, EarlyView.
Ferroelectric nanoclusters create local internal fields in a normally non‐switchable polar film because of polarization mismatch at their interfaces. That field opposes polarization in the regions with larger polarization and reinforces polarization in the regions with smaller polarization.

Multilineage Potential of Side Population Cells from Human Amnion Mesenchymal Layer

open access: yesCell Transplantation, 2008
Side population (SP) cells were isolated by FACS from a human amnion mesenchymal cell (AMC) layer soon after enzyme treatment. The yield of SP cells from AMC layer (AMC-SP cells) was about 0.1–0.2%.
